Chief Justice of India, DY Chandrachud, and other Supreme Court judges honored Pragya, the daughter of a Supreme Court cook, for securing scholarships to pursue a Master's degree in Law at either the University of California or the University of Michigan in the United States. The judges gifted Pragya three books on the Indian Constitution signed by all the apex court judges and expressed hope that she would return to serve the country upon completing her studies. Pragya, a law researcher, considers CJI Chandrachud her inspiration.
